A delightful site like Burrell Bay here at Marsh Wood Lake is too wonderful to miss, and Fayetteville Koa is a good local campground. Marsh Wood Lake frequently gets a good deal of rainfall; the month of July is the wettest with most of the rain; November meanwhile is the driest
 
               month. Summertime highs at Marsh Wood Lake usually tend to be in the 80's. Once the sun is down it sinks down to the 60's. Through the winter the highs are frequently in the 50's while the cold winter nights at Marsh Wood Lake are in the 20's.
